Filtration System

The Ecogecko filtration stack typically features:

  • Pre-filter to capture large particles and extend the life of the higher-grade filters.
  • True HEPA or HEPA-like filter capable of capturing 99.97% of 0.3-micron particles in ideal conditions.
  • Activated carbon layer to reduce odors, VOCs, and some gaseous pollutants.

Filtration effectiveness depends on proper seal, filter quality, and air exchange rate. Replacement intervals commonly range from 6 to 12 months for the main filter, with the pre-filter needing more frequent checks. When measuring performance, review CADR (clean air delivery rate) values for smoke, dust, and pollen to gauge effectiveness against different pollutants.

Performance And Real-World Testing

In controlled tests, the Ecogecko air purifier often demonstrates solid particle reduction in small-to-medium rooms. A typical CADR for smoke or dust may fall within a range that supports noticeable air-cleaning benefits within 15 to 30 minutes in a standard bedroom or home office. Real-world performance depends on room volume, ceiling height, and whether doors or windows are left open. Auto-mode or smart controls (if available) can adapt fan speed based on sensor readings, helping to optimize purification while minimizing energy use.

Energy Efficiency And Noise

Energy use is generally modest due to smaller fans and efficient motors. The Ecogecko may be labeled Energy Star or follow similar standards in regions where applicable. Noise levels typically range from a quiet background hum on lower settings to a noticeable but non-distracting level at higher speeds. For sensitive sleepers or workspaces, the lowest or auto mode is recommended to maintain a peaceful environment while still delivering clean air.
